FKIE_CVE-2025-3083

Vulnerability from fkie_nvd - Published: 2025-04-01 12:15 - Updated: 2025-09-22 14:15
Summary
Specifically crafted MongoDB wire protocol messages can cause mongos to crash during command validation. This can occur without using an authenticated connection. This issue affects MongoDB v5.0 versions prior to 5.0.31,  MongoDB v6.0 versions prior to 6.0.20 and MongoDB v7.0 versions prior to 7.0.16
